Pricing Methodology Legend

  • Code 1: The NADAC was calculated using information from the most recently completed pharmacy survey.
  • Code 2: The average acquisition cost of the most recent survey was within ± 2% of the current NADAC; therefore, the NADAC was carried forward from the previous file.
  • Code 3: The NADAC based on survey data has been adjusted to reflect changes in published pricing, or as a result of an inquiry to the help desk.
  • Code 4: The NADAC was carried forward from the previous file.
  • Code 5: The NADAC was calculated based on package size.

Understanding NADAC Pricing Data

The National Average Drug Acquisition Cost (NADAC) is compiled by the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S). This data is derived from random monthly surveys of more than 60,000 pharmacies across all 50 states.


Important Price Distinction:

The prices listed on this page represent the wholesale invoice price paid by pharmacies to acquire the drug. This is NOT the retail price paid by consumers at the pharmacy counter. Final patient costs typically include pharmacy markups, professional dispensing fees, and insurance adjustments.
